Public Hearing,• <br />CA: ConsentAgenda; CB: Council Business <br />City of Mounds View Staff Report <br />To: Honorable Mayor & City Council <br />From: James Ericson, Planning Associate <br />Item Title/Subject: Discussion Regarding Proposed Ordinance 632, an Ordinance <br />Amending Chapter 1113 of the Zoning Code Pertaining to Permitted <br />Uses within the B-2, Limited Business Zoning District; Special <br />Planning Case No. SP -072-99 <br />Date of Report: June 29, 1999 <br />Background: <br />Staff has issued a building permit to Kraus Anderson to do interior remodeling work within Silver <br />View Plaza, located at 2540 Highway 10, for a private educational institution --Calvin Academy. The <br />subject property is zoned B-2, Limited Business, which does not specifically permit such a use. <br />Attached is some information regarding Calvin Academy for your reference. <br />Discussion: <br />One of the problems with our Zoning Code is its rigidity. Each district has a specific set of uses, <br />sometimes referred to as the "laundry list" of uses, yet it is impossible to include every possible <br />appropriate use, so there is often the need to make interpretations. <br />According to Section 1113.01 of the Code, "The purpose of the B-2, Limited Business District is to <br />provide for low intensity, retail or service outlets which deal directly with the customer for whom the <br />goods or services are furnished. The uses allowed in this District are to provide goods and services <br />on a limited community market scale and located in areas which are well served by collector or <br />arterial street facilities at the edge of residential districts." A small-scale educational facility such as <br />that proposed seems to meet with the purpose and intent of the Code, which was the basis for staff's <br />interpretation. <br />To eliminate any subsequent questions regarding this type of use, staff proposes that it be added to <br />the list of permitted uses within the B-2 district. If no action is taken, Calvin Academy would <br />operate and function by virtue of an administrative Code interpretation rather than by an explicit <br />reference in the Code. <br />Recommendation: <br />Staff requests that the Council review the attached proposed ordinance and provide any feedback or <br />suggestions that can be incorporated prior to the first reading of the ordinance. <br />James Ericson, Planning Associate <br />N:\DATA\GROUPS\COMDEV\SPECPROASP071-99\WORKSESS.RPT <br />
